7 Days in Egypt: The Perfect First-Timer Itinerary and Guide

Golden Mask icon
This efficient 7-Day First-Timer Itinerary focuses strictly on Egypt's essential highlights. Start in Cairo and Giza to see the Pyramids and the Sphinx. You then fly to Aswan and board your Nile Cruise, visiting major temples like Philae, Kom Ombo, and Edfu. The journey concludes in Luxor with the Valley of the Kings and Karnak Temple before your final flight back to Cairo.
